John Murray, 1875. Hardcover. Acceptable. 1875. No edition stated. 416 pages. No dust jacket. Fully bound in blue leather with decoration to spine. Contains black and white illustrations. Ex-Libris plate stuck to front pastedown. Pages remain bright and clear with minimal tanning and foxing. Frontispiece torn but still attached. Binding remains firm. Pen inscriptions to front endpapers. Decorative text block edges. Boards have heavy edge-wear with bumping to corners, crushing to spine ends and rub wear all over. Gilt lettering to heavily sunned spine is dulled. Chips to head and tail of spine and small splits to joints.
